>>
>> This should be vb2_is_busy(). Once buffers are allocated you are no longer allowed
>> to change the format, regardless of whether you are streaming or not.

>>
>> No, this should happen when the driver is initialized. The format is
>> persistent over open()/close() calls so should not be re-initialized
>> here.

> sun6i_video_init is in the driver probe context. sun6i_video_formats_init
> use media_entity_remote_pad and media_entity_to_v4l2_subdev to find the
> subdevs.
> The media_entity_remote_pad can't work before all the media pad linked.

A video_init is typically called from the notify_complete callback.
Actually, that's where the video_register_device should be created as well.
When you create it in probe() there is possibly no sensor yet, so it would
be a dead video node (or worse, crash when used).

There are still a lot of platform drivers that create the video node in the
probe, but it's not the right place if you rely on the async loading of
subdevs.
